Here is a comprehensive guide to finding remote online casino jobs worldwide, including the types of roles available, legitimate companies to target, and crucial red flags to avoid. The global iGaming industry is massive, and many roles are fully remote. However, the industry is heavily regulated, so "worldwide" usually means you can work from anywhere provided you are a legal adult and in a jurisdiction where online gambling is permitted. Types of Remote Online Casino Jobs These are the most common legitimate remote positions in the industry: Customer Support (Most Entry-Level) Role: Answering player queries via live chat, email, or phone. Often requires shift work (24/7). Skills: Excellent English (other languages like German, Swedish, Finnish, or Japanese are a massive plus), patience, problem-solving. Typical Salary: 800 - 2,500/month depending on language and experience. VIP Account Management Role: Managing high-roller (VIP) players. Building relationships, offering bonuses, handling complaints, and ensuring player retention. Skills: Sales-oriented, excellent communication, CRM knowledge, discretion. Typical Salary: 2,000 - 5,000+/month plus commission. Marketing & Affiliate Management Role: Promoting the casino through digital channels (SEO, PPC, Social Media) or managing a network of affiliate partners who send players. Skills: Digital marketing, data analysis, negotiation. Typical Salary: 1,500 - 4,000/month. Game Development & Software Engineering Role: Building the games (slots, table games) or the platform backend. Roles include Unity/C# developers, backend engineers (Node.js, Python, PHP), and QA testers. Skills: Strong technical portfolio, understanding of RNG (Random Number Generators) is a plus. Typical Salary: 3,000 - 10,000+/month (highly skilled). Payments & Fraud Prevention Role: Processing withdrawals/deposits, verifying player documents (KYC), and detecting bonus abuse or fraudulent activity. Skills: Attention to detail, familiarity with payment gateways (Neteller, Skrill, Crypto), analytical thinking. Typical Salary: 1,500 - 3,500/month. Data Analysis & Risk Management Role: Analyzing player behavior, game performance, and financial risk. Often called "Trading" or "Sportsbook Risk Manager." Skills: Excel, SQL, Python, statistical analysis. Typical Salary: 2,500 - 6,000/month. How to Find Legitimate Remote Jobs Avoid generic job boards like Craigslist or general "work from home" scams. Use these specialized channels: Industry-Specific Job Boards: - CasinoJobs.com Focused on land-based and online. - iGamingJobs.com The leading global job board for the industry. - GamblingJobs.com Similar to the above. LinkedIn: - Search for keywords: "iGaming", "Online Casino", "Remote", "Sportsbook", "VIP Manager". - Filter by "Remote" and "Worldwide". - Follow companies like: Evolution Gaming (live dealer), Playtech, Microgaming, Betsson Group, Kindred Group (Unibet), Entain, DraftKings (US-focused), Flutter Entertainment (PokerStars, FanDuel). Freelance Platforms: - Upwork / Freelancer: Good for short-term projects (game testing, translation, graphic design for casino affiliates). - Search for "iGaming copywriter" or "casino SEO". Top Legitimate Companies Hiring Remotely (Worldwide) These are well-known, regulated operators that often have remote roles: Company Known For Typical Remote Roles : : : Evolution Gaming Live Casino Studio Technology Developers, Game Presenters (studio-based), Support Betsson Group Large European Operator VIP, Marketing, Support, Payments Kindred Group Unibet, 32Red Risk & Trading, Data Analysis, Compliance Entain Ladbrokes, Coral, bwin Engineering, Product Management, Customer Ops LeoVegas Mobile-First Casino Marketing, VIP, Tech DraftKings US Daily Fantasy & Sportsbook Engineering, Customer Support (US-based preferred) SoftGamings White Label & Aggregator Sales, Support, Integration Managers Livespins Innovative Slot Streaming Marketing, Account Management Countries & Regions with the Most Opportunities While "worldwide" is advertised, you will have the most luck if you are based in or willing to work in these time zones: Malta: The Silicon Valley of iGaming. Many companies are registered here. Expect European time zones. Gibraltar / Isle of Man / UK: Major licensing hubs. Cyprus: A growing hub, especially for Russian-language and Eastern European companies. Costa Rica / Panama: Many "white label" operators and payment processors are based here. Eastern Europe (Romania, Bulgaria, Ukraine, Georgia): Massive talent pool for developers, support, and VIP management. Lower salary expectations but high competition. Critical Red Flags & Scams to Avoid The online casino industry is full of scams, especially targeting remote workers. "We'll send you a check to buy equipment" Classic scam. Legitimate companies will send a company laptop directly or use a corporate account. Upfront Payment for "Training" or "Licensing" No legitimate casino will ask you to pay to get hired. Vague Job Description "Work from home, make 5k a week, no experience needed." This is always a scam. Crypto-Only "Unlicensed" Casinos If you cannot find the company's license number (e.g., from Malta Gaming Authority, UK Gambling Commission), they are likely unregulated and may not pay you. "Lucky Trader" or "Sports Betting Tipster" Roles These are often pyramid schemes or illegal unlicensed operations. You are the product, not the employee. Requesting Your Bank Details for "Payroll" Before an Interview A major identity theft red flag. How to Apply (Pro-Tips) Tailor Your CV: Use industry keywords like KYC (Know Your Customer), AML (Anti-Money Laundering), RNG, RTP (Return to Player), CRM, P&L (Profit & Loss) . Highlight Shift Flexibility: Casinos operate 24/7. Mentioning you are happy to work nights, weekends, or rotating shifts is a huge advantage. Emphasize Multi-Lingual Skills: If you speak a second language (especially German, French, Spanish, Portuguese, or Nordic languages), put it at the top of your CV. It is the most valuable asset for support and VIP roles. Understand Licensing: If you are in the US, you can only work for companies licensed in specific states (New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Michigan, etc.). "Worldwide" from the US is very difficult unless you are doing tech work for a company outside the US. Final Verdict: Legitimate remote online casino jobs do exist, but they require specific skills and are concentrated in a few key regions. Focus on Customer Support (if you speak a second language) or Tech/Data roles (if you have hard skills) for the best chance of success.
